Dentist

Cherokee Nation
$153,520 - $190,371 a year
Muskogee County, Oklahoma
Full time
3 days ago
Job Summary:

Serves as a staff Dentist for the dental unit with responsibilities for performing a variety of professional tasks of average technical and administrative difficulty in conformance with established criteria and guidelines.

Job Duties:

Routine duties shall include providing health care services to individuals eligible for services in accordance with the self-governance compact and funding agreement between the Cherokee Nation and the United States executed under the authority of the Indian Self-Determination and Education Assistance Act. Employee(s) will have contact with the general public, patients and patient's families, and in a clinical situation in order to provide reputable dental care and further the goals and objectives of the dental program. Performs all phases of General Dentistry and provides dental services of a scope, quality, and quantity consistent with Cherokee Nation policies. Volunteers to provide supportive services to the Dental Clinic Supervisor to attain clinic goals and objectives. Keeps accurate records of treatment and treatment planning. Performs routine examinations to determine needed treatments. Prescribes medication when needed. Maintains educational requirements. Assures Cherokee Nation Health Services objectives are met. Adheres to professional ethical standards. Other duties may be assigned.


S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ES

Minimal supervisory responsibility (i.e., lead position)

Qualifications:

E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ENT

Doctoral degree; no substitutions. Graduate of a dental school accredited by the Commission on Dental Accreditation with either a D.D.S. or D.M.D. degree.


E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ENT

No additional experience required.


COMPUTER SKILLS

To perform this job successfully, an individual should have knowledge of Contact Management systems; Database software and Spreadsheet software.


C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S

Must possess an Oklahoma State Dental license and maintain CPR certification. Must possess a valid driver's license with a driving history verified through a motor vehicle report that meets requirements for Cherokee Nation underwriting rating.


OTHER QUALIFICATIONS

The employee must not be and will not be under sanction by the United States Department of Health and Human Services Office of the Inspector General (OIG) or by the General Services Administration (GSA) or listed on the OIG's Cumulative Sanction Report, or the GSA's List of Excluded Providers, or listed on the OIG's List of Excluded Individuals/Entities (LEIE). Must meet and maintain pre-employment and periodic background investigation and adjudication for child care.


PHYSICAL DEMANDS

While performing the duties of this Job, the employee is regularly required to walk; sit; use h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ach with hands and arms; st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l and talk or hear. The employee is frequently required to stand. The employee is occasionally required to climb or balance and taste or smell. The employee must regularly lift and /or move up to 10 pounds and occasionally lift and/or move more than 100 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us.


WORK ENVIRONMENT

While performing the duties of this Job, the employee is regularly exposed to moving mechanical parts; fumes or airborne particles; risk of radiation and vibration. The employee is occ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ions; high, precarious places; toxic or caustic chemicals; outside weather conditions; extreme cold; extreme heat and risk of electrical shock.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ate.
